Alexandra Kontos is a highly accomplished legal practitioner who co-founded the law firm Walker Kontos with Peter Walker in 1988. She began her legal career in Kenya in 1979, at a time when female lawyers were few in number and even fewer had attained the status of partner. Currently, she holds the position of senior partner at Walker Kontos.


Alexandra's academic qualifications include a Bachelor of Laws degree from Addis Ababa University and a Master of Laws degree from University College London. She is a Chartered Institute of Arbitrators Fellow and an experienced company secretary. Throughout her extensive career, Alexandra has served in various capacities in legal drafting and law reform. She greatly enjoys mentoring young lawyers and imparting her knowledge to them.



Her specialty is corporate and commercial law, with a particular focus on mergers and acquisitions, including transnational acquisitions, banking, and corporate finance. As a leader of legal teams involved in establishing joint ventures, mergers, acquisitions, disposals, corporate restructuring, and management buy-outs, Alexandra has provided invaluable guidance. She has advised on various banking and financial transactions, such as project finance, loan syndication and securitization, and structured and trade finance. She has represented most Kenyan banks, their overseas branches, and many international finance organizations, including IFC, FMO, Proparco, EIB, and various other international lenders, in loan transactions, some amounting to millions of dollars or euros. In the legal profession, Alexandra is highly respected, and her name evokes admiration and recognition.


Besides her corporate and commercial law expertise, Alexandra is also an accomplished property lawyer. Her forte is due diligence on titles, an area of law that requires a high level of understanding, especially due to recent changes in land registration in Kenya. Consequently, she has played a significant role in various high-end property deals involving hundreds of units in several areas of Nairobi and its environs.


In addition to the above, Alexandra is a polyglot fluent in six languages. She is also the Senior Judge of the Kenya Orchid Society, which she has enthusiastically led for the past thirty years.
